# Java不同实体对象比较Java编程中,经常需要比较不同实体对象比较目的可能是为了判断它们是否相等,或者确定它们大小关系。本文将介绍Java不同实体对象比较方法,包括基本类型、引用类型和自定义类型比较。 ## 基本类型比较Java中,基本类型比较可以直接通过==符号来进行。基本类型包括int、float、double、char、boolean等。例如: `
原创 2024-05-09 07:29:44
53阅读
StringBuilder content = new StringBuilder(); var beforeMembers = BeforeDTO.GetType().GetProperties(); var afterMembers = AfterDTO.GetType().GetPropert ...
i++
转载 2021-07-28 09:55:00
123阅读
2评论
# Java实体比较对象属性 ## 1. 引言 在Java开发中,经常会遇到需要比较两个对象属性是否相同情况。比如在测试中,我们需要验证某个方法返回值是否符合预期,或者在数据库操作中,需要比对两个实体对象属性差异。本文将介绍如何实现Java实体比较对象属性。 ## 2. 实现流程 下面是实现比较Java实体对象属性流程,可以用表格展示如下: | 步骤 | 描述 | | -
原创 2023-12-24 04:03:25
61阅读
## Java中List比较内容对象不同Java编程中,经常会遇到需要比较List中对象值是否相同情况。然而,对于List对象比较,并不像比较基本数据类型那么简单,需要注意对象引用和值比较。本文将介绍如何比较List中对象不同,并通过代码示例进行说明。 ### 1. List对象比较Java中,List是一个接口,可以存储一组有序对象。当我们需要比较List中
原创 2024-03-05 06:15:16
207阅读
Java比较两个对象不同是一个常见需求。特别是在多层应用中,服务间数据同步、调试等场景,都需要确保对象一致性或发现其差异。本文将系统地探讨如何比较Java对象不同,方法、工具与实践相结合,从技术层面进行深入分析。 ## 背景定位 在软件开发领域,稳定对象比较是关键环节,尤其是在数据操作频繁业务场景中,比如电子商务、用户管理等。对象比较不仅涉及到属性值对比,还涉及到对象状态
原创 6月前
13阅读
# 实现Java对象比较找出不同数据方法 ## 背景介绍 作为一名经验丰富开发者,我将会教你如何实现Java对象比较,找出不同数据。这对于刚入行小白来说可能是一个挑战,但是只要跟着我步骤走,你将会很容易地掌握这个技能。 ## 流程图 ```mermaid flowchart TD A[创建两个对象列表] --> B[比较两个对象列表] B --> C[找出不同
原创 2024-02-23 05:12:27
74阅读
# Java对象比较找出不同属性实现方法 作为一名经验丰富开发者,你可能会在工作中遇到需要比较两个Java对象不同属性情况。在本文中,我将向你展示如何实现Java对象比较,并找出它们之间不同属性。 ## 流程概览 在开始编写代码之前,让我们先概述一下整个流程。下表展示了实现这一目标的步骤: ```mermaid journey title Java对象比较找出不同属性
原创 2023-10-08 10:45:13
304阅读
在今天开发过程中,比较两个对象不同属性是一个非常常见但又常常被忽视问题。无论是在重构代码还是调试时,开发者都可能面临需要找出两个对象之间细微差异。为了更好地理解这个问题,我们将通过不同维度来进行深入探讨,以便大家在实际场景中能够更加高效地应对类似的挑战。 > 引用块: > “在软件开发中,理解和改善对象之间比较是推动代码质量重要过程。” —《现代软件工程原则》 ### 背景定位
# Java 实体比较 ## 1. 概述 在实际开发工作中,经常需要对 Java 实体进行比较,判断它们是否相等或者大小关系。对于刚入行开发者来说,可能还不清楚如何实现这个过程。本文将详细介绍 Java 实体比较流程以及每一步所需代码。 ## 2. 流程 实现 Java 实体比较一般流程如下所示: | 步骤 | 描述 | | ---- | ---- | | 1 | 创建实
原创 2023-08-07 08:23:15
225阅读
以下介绍两种不同克隆方法,浅克隆(ShallowClone)和深克隆(DeepClone)。在Java语言中,数据类型分为值类型(基本数据类型)和引用类型,值类型包括int、double、byte、boolean、char等简单数据类型,引用类型包括类、接口、数组等复杂类型。浅克隆和深克隆主要区别在于是否支持引用类型成员变量复制,下面将对两者进行详细介绍。一、浅克隆在Java语言中,通过覆
Java数据类型分两种:1. 8个基本类型(原始类型): 四个整数型 (1)byte:byte数据类型是8位; (2)short:short数据类型是16位; (3)int: int数据类型是32位; (4)long:long数据类型是64位; 两个浮点型 (5)float:float数据类型是32位(单精度浮点数); (6)double:double数据类型是64位(双精度浮点数); 一
比较两个Java List对象不同可以分为以下几个步骤: 1. 创建两个List对象用于比较。 2. 比较两个List对象长度是否相等,如果不相等,则直接判断两个List对象不同。 3. 如果长度相等,则遍历其中一个List对象元素,逐个与另一个List对象元素进行比较。 4. 对于每个元素比较,可以使用equals方法或者自定义比较方法进行比较。 5. 如果存在不同元素,则记录下
原创 2023-10-05 14:21:30
79阅读
# Java比较返回两个对象不同值 在Java编程中,经常需要比较两个对象是否相等。在某些情况下,我们可能需要判断两个对象是否有不同值,而不只是比较它们引用地址。本文将介绍如何在Java比较两个对象返回它们不同值。 ## equals方法比较两个对象值 在Java中,我们通常使用equals方法来比较两个对象值是否相同。对象equals方法默认是比较对象引用地址,如果我们需
原创 2024-02-26 05:01:27
129阅读
java反射机制1.什么是Java反射机制2.Java反射机制作用3.反射常用对象3.1Class类代码实现3.2Constructor类3.2.1相关API查询代码实现3.3Field类3.3.1相关Api查询代码实现3.4Method类3.4.1相关Api查询代码实现4.反射使用5.问题:为什么java反射可以调用私有属性,这样私有就没有意义? 1.什么是Java反射机制通俗说:反射机制
Java设计模式相关面试这里面试一些简单面试题Java高级面试设计模式 这里面试一些简单面试题1.接口是什么?为什么要使用接口而不是直接使用具体类?接口用于定义 API。它定义了类必须得遵循规则。同时,它提供了一种抽象,因为客户端只使用接口,这样可以有多重实现,如 List 接口,你可以使用可随机访问 ArrayList,也可以使用方便插入和删除 LinkedList。接口中不允许写代
不同字体比较Java开发中是一个重要主题,尤其是在UI/UX设计和打印功能中。本文将深入分析Java环境中不同字体比较问题,帮助工程师在项目中做出更合适选择。 ## 背景定位 在Java中,不同字体应用对用户界面的呈现效果有显著优势,合理字体选择不仅能提升可读性,还能增强了用户体验。随着Java技术不断演进,支持字体种类和样式也越来越多,如何在不同字体之间进行有效比较成为
原创 7月前
43阅读
# Java 不同实体转换 在Java编程中,我们经常会遇到需要将不同实体之间进行转换情况。比如,将一个对象转换为另一个对象,或将一个集合转换为另一个集合。这种转换通常涉及到不同数据结构之间转换,或者是需要对数据进行不同处理。在本文中,我们将介绍如何在Java中进行不同实体转换,以及一些常见转换技巧和代码示例。 ## 实体转换基本概念 实体转换是指将一个实体转化为另一个实体过程
原创 2024-06-17 04:47:41
106阅读
# Java不同实体List合并 在Java编程中,我们经常需要处理不同实体集合,例如List。有时候,我们需要将多个实体List合并成一个新List。本文将介绍如何使用Java编程语言实现不同实体List合并,并给出相应代码示例。 ## 合并两个List 首先,让我们看一个简单场景,如何合并两个List。假设我们有两个List,分别是ListA和ListB,它们元素类型可
原创 2023-11-30 08:58:41
185阅读
1.看下面的代码,输出什么呢?Integer n1 = new Integer(127); Integer n2 = new Integer(127); System.out.println("n1 == n2:" + (n1 == n2));//false Integer n3 = 127; Integer n4 = 127; System.out.println("n3 == n4:" +
转载 2024-06-06 23:21:32
53阅读
一、j2ee中,经常提到几种对象(object),理解他们含义有助于我们更好理解面向对象设计思维。 ORM是Object Relational Mapping【对象关系映射】缩写 通俗点讲,就是将对象与关系数据库绑定,用对象来表示关系数据。在O/RMapping世界里, 有一系列重要对象,常见有VO,PO,DTO,POJO,DAO,BO。 1、Java各种对象(PO,BO,VO
转载 2023-07-20 17:23:16
33阅读
  • 1
  • 2
  • 3
  • 4
  • 5